No, skinny jeans do not cause cancer. Cancer is characterized by a mutation in cells, which cannot be caused by tight pants.

However, tight pants such as skinny jeans can put pressure on the lateral femoral cutaneous nerve causing a numbness or tingling sensation in the legs. Also, women who wear tight clothing often are at risk for yeast infections. In men, tight pants can reduce fertility.

The best advice is to not wear them too often. And if they are not comfortable, don't wear them at all.
